Method 1: Using Third-Party Software

One of the most effective ways to screen mirror your iPhone to an HP laptop is by using third-party software. Here, we focus on two popular applications: ApowerMirror and LetsView.

ApowerMirror: A Comprehensive Solution

ApowerMirror is a powerful application that allows for full-screen mirroring, allowing users to access various functionalities and play games directly from their iPhone on their HP laptop.

Steps to Use ApowerMirror

  1. Download and install the ApowerMirror application on your HP laptop from the official website.
  2. Open the application on your laptop.
  3. On your iPhone, download the ApowerMirror app from the App Store.
  4. Ensure both devices are connected to the same Wi-Fi network.
  5. Launch the ApowerMirror app on your iPhone, tap on “Mirror” and select the name of your laptop from the list of devices.
  6. A notification may appear on your iPhone asking for permission to start mirroring. Confirm it to proceed.

With these simple steps, your iPhone screen will be displayed on your HP laptop, allowing you to enjoy a bigger view of your content.

LetsView: A Free Mirroring Tool

LetsView is another exceptional tool for screen mirroring your iPhone to HP. It’s user-friendly and offers similar features as ApowerMirror, but with a focus on simplicity and free usage.

Steps to Use LetsView

  1. Download the LetsView application on your HP laptop from its official website.
  2. Install and launch the software.
  3. Download the LetsView app on your iPhone from the App Store.
  4. Connect both devices to the same Wi-Fi network.
  5. Open LetsView on both devices and select “iOS Screen Mirroring”.
  6. Choose your laptop from the list of available devices and tap “Start Broadcast”.

This method provides you with an easy way to enjoy the contents of your iPhone on a larger screen.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Even with the best setups, issues can arise when screen mirroring. Below are common problems and potential solutions:

Lagging Screen

  • If the mirroring is lagging, check your Wi-Fi connection. A slow connection can cause latency.
  • Reduce the distance between your devices for a stronger signal.

Unable to Find Device

  • Ensure both devices are on the same Wi-Fi network.
  • Restart both your iPhone and HP laptop.

Mirroring Not Working

  • Update your software on both devices to the latest version.
  • Try uninstalling and reinstalling the third-party app if applicable.

Can I screen mirror my iPhone to my HP laptop without an internet connection?

Yes, it is possible to mirror your iPhone to your HP laptop without an internet connection, provided you utilize the right software that supports direct connections such as a USB cable or local Wi-Fi network features. For instance, some applications allow you to connect your iPhone to your laptop via a USB cable, ensuring that the mirroring process does not depend on internet access.

Another option is to create a local network using mobile hotspot features available on your iPhone. This way, you can connect your HP laptop to this mobile hotspot. Once both devices are connected, you can use compatible screen mirroring software to initiate the mirroring process effectively.
